  • How tow connect two external displays that are not mirrored and turn of the retina display

    Hello,
    I have two questions:
    1.  Is it possible to use two external displays either mirrored or not and turn off the retina display, and if so how it is done?
    2.  Is it possible to close the MBP and use an external keyboard while using two external displays?
    I am using a music production DAW Persons Studio One-2 Pro and it would be great to be able to have this type of a setup.
    Thank You,
    Breezinabout
    Macbook Pro  15" Retina display I7 2,3mz 500gb SSD late 2013  OSX Yosemite 10.10.1

    Hi Breezinabout,
    The MacBook Pro Late 2013 retina display model will support two external displays. See this specifications page for reference -
    MacBook Pro (Retina, 15-inch, Late 2013) - Technical Specifications
    Specifically -
    Dual display and video mirroring: Simultaneously supports full native resolution on the built-in display and up to 2560 by 1600 pixels on up to two external displays, both at millions of colors
    And -
    Thunderbolt digital video output
    Native Mini DisplayPort output
    DVI output using Mini DisplayPort to DVI Adapter (sold separately)
    VGA output using Mini DisplayPort to VGA Adapter (sold separately)
    Dual-link DVI output using Mini DisplayPort to Dual-Link DVI Adapter (sold separately)
    HDMI video output
    Support for 1080p resolution at up to 60Hz
    Support for 3840-by-2160 resolution at 30Hz
    Support for 4096-by-2160 resolution at 24Hz
    You would, if you wish, turn off the internal display by closing the MacBook Pro, which is called "closed-clamshell" mode. It requires you to have an external keyboard and mouse. See this article for further information -
    How to use your Mac notebook computer in closed-clamshell (display closed) mode with an external display - Apple Support

  • Cost for replacement for the retina display on my iphone 4S

    I droped my iPhone 4s and theres a large strip of dead pixals on the left edge plus a liquid that has crept over the top left coner of my screen.  I also have many arrayed dead pixals across my screen. 
    I am thinking of replacing the retina display but im not sure how much it will cost.
    Does anyone have had this problem or had it fixed?
    Thankyou

    Out-of-Warranty Service
    If you own an iPhone that is ineligible for warranty service but is eligible for Out-of-Warranty (OOW) Service, Apple will service your iPhone for the Out-of-Warranty Service fee listed below.
    iPhone model
    Out-of-Warranty Service
    iPhone 5
    $229
    iPhone 4S
    $199
    iPhone 4, iPhone 3GS,
    iPhone 3G, Original iPhone
    $149
    A $6.95 shipping fee will be added if service is arranged through Apple and requires shipping. All fees are in U.S. dollars and are subject to local tax.
